Small Business Disaster Loans and Unemployment Insurance
SBA Disaster Loans
- Receive low interest SBA disaster loans to businesses and private nonprofits
- Available for current and future disaster assistance declarations related to Coronavirus
- Approved up to $2 million in assistance to small businesses to help overcome temporary loss of revenue
- Pay fixed debts, payroll, accounts payable and other bills that can’t be paid because of the disaster’s impact
- Repayment terms up to 30 years
- Small business interest rate – 3.75%
- Non-profit interest rate – 2.75%
- Terms determined case-by-case
- Small business owners in all U.S. states and territories are currently eligible to apply for a low-interest loan due to Coronavirus (COVID-19)
- Possibly 90+ days before loan money is received

Unemployment Insurance
For Employees
- Benefits are available to individuals who are unemployed through no fault of their own
- Out of work because employer must shut down operations due to COVID-19
- In mandatory quarantine*
- Ill because of COVID-19 and unable to work*
- Working reduced hours due to COVID-19 (in some cases)
- Unable to work because they are caring for an immediate family member who is diagnosed with COVID-19*
- Individuals who work for themselves, religious organizations, and some nonprofits are not eligible
*Proof of medical diagnosis for the claimant and/or the immediate family member, and/or confirmation of quarantine required.
For Employers
- Unemployment taxes will not increase because of COVID-19
